Excerpt: Conemaugh Generating Station The Conemaugh Generating Station is a 1,711 MW baseload coal -powered plant located on 1,750 acres (7.1 km ) at 40°23 05 N 79°03 49 W / 40.38472°N 79.06361°W / 40.38472; -79.06361Coordinates : 40°23 05 N 79°03 49 W / 40.38472°N 79.06361°W / 40.38472; -79.06361, across the Conemaugh River from New Florence in Western Pennsylvania .The station generates enough electricity to light 17 million 100-watt bulbs. The facility consists of two steam turbines , which began commercial operation in 1970 and 1971, and two cooling towers .The main turbines run on steam produced by twin year-around 850 MWe boilers , each as tall as a 14-story building. Excerpt: Radio-controlled helicopters (also RC helicopters) are model aircraft which are distinct from RC airplanes because of the differences in construction, aerodynamics, and flight training. Several basic designs of RC helicopters exist, of which some (such as those with collective pitch, meaning blades which rotate on their longitudinal axis to vary or reverse lift) are more maneuverable than others. The more maneuverable designs are often harder to fly, but benefit from greater aerobatic capabilities. Flight controls allow pilots to control the collective and throttle (usually linked together), the cyclic controls (pitch and roll), and the tail rotor (yaw). Controlling these in unison enables the helicopter to perform most of the same manoeuvres as full-sized helicopters, such as hovering and backwards flight, and many that full-sized helicopters cannot. The various helicopter controls are effected by means of small servo motors, commonly known as servos. A piezoelectric gyroscope is typically used on the tail rotor (yaw) control to counter wind- and torque-reaction-induced tail movement. This “gyro” does not itself apply a mechanical force, but electronically adjusts the control signal to the tail rotor servo. The engines typically used to be methanol-powered two-stroke motors, but electric brushless motors combined with a high-performance lithium polymer battery are now more common, as improved performance and decreasing prices bring these within reach of more people. Gasoline and jet turbine engines are also used. Common power sources are Nitro (nitromethane-methanol internal combustion), electric batteries, gas turbines, petrol and gasoline.
